Overview Tithro 500 Tablet

Azithromycin 500mg tablets combat bacterial infections affecting the respiratory system, ears, nose, throat, lungs, skin, and eyes in both adults and children. This antibiotic is also effective against typhoid fever and certain sexually transmitted infections such as gonorrhea. Administer orally, ideally an hour before or two hours after meals, following your doctor's prescribed schedule for consistent, evenly spaced doses. Complete the entire course of treatment, even with symptom improvement; premature discontinuation may cause relapse or infection exacerbation. Typical, often transient side effects include nausea, vomiting, abdominal discomfort, headache, and diarrhea. Persistent or concerning side effects warrant immediate medical consultation. Prior to use, disclose any history of azithromycin-induced cholestatic jaundice or liver impairment, allergies, or cardiac conditions. Pregnant or lactating individuals should seek medical advice before commencing treatment.

How Tithro 500 Tablet works:

Tithro 500mg tablets are antibacterial medications. Their mechanism of action involves disrupting the production of crucial bacterial proteins, thereby inhibiting bacterial growth and halting infection progression.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holUNSAFE

Combining Tithro 500 Tablet and alcohol is not advisable.

PregnancyPreg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Using Tithro 500 Tablet during pregnancy is typically deemed safe.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or no negative impacts on fetal development; human data on this, however, remains scarce.

Breast feedingBreast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Tithro 500 Tablet is considered safe for use while breastfeeding.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, posing no apparent risk to the infant. However, infant diarrhea or rash remains a potential, albeit unlikely, side effect.

DrivingDrivingSAFE

Driving ability is typically unaffected by Tithro 500 Tablet.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with significant k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Tithro 500 Tablets.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should exercise caution when using Tithro 500 Tablets;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.

What if you forget to take Tithro 500 Tablet :

Should you forget a Tithro 500 Tablet dose, take it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ing pattern.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on Tithro 500 Tablet

Using Tithro 500 Tablets as directed by your doctor is safe.
If your symptoms haven't improved after three days of taking Tithro 500 Tablet, or if they worsen, contact your doctor immediately.
Diarrhea is a possible side effect of Tithro 500 Tablets. This antibiotic eliminates harmful bacteria, but can also disrupt beneficial gut bacteria, leading to diarrhea. Consult your doctor if you experience severe diarrhea.
Take one Tithro 500 Tablet daily, at the same time each day. It can be taken with or without food, ideally one hour before or two hours after meals. Always follow your doctor's instructions precisely; consult them if you have any questions.
Tithro 500 Tablet typically begins to work within hours, with noticeable symptom improvement often seen within days. Always complete the full course of treatment prescribed by your doctor; prematurely stopping the medication can lead to a recurring infection, potentially harder to treat.
Treatment length varies depending on the infection and patient age. Tithro 500 Tablet isn't always prescribed for three days. Typical bacterial infections may require 500mg daily for three days, or 500mg on day one followed by 250mg daily from day two to five. For conditions like genital ulcer disease, a single 1 gram dose might be prescribed. Always follow your doctor's instructions.
To maximize its effectiveness, avoid taking antacids with Tithro 500 Tablet. Also, limit sun exposure and tanning beds, as this medication increases sunburn risk.
Tithro 500 Tablet is a potent antibiotic treating various bacterial infections. Its extended half-life allows for once-daily dosing over a shorter treatment period, unlike other antibiotics, which often require two to four daily doses due to their shorter half-lives.
Tithro 500 Tablet, an antibiotic, can sometimes disrupt the balance of gut bacteria, potentially leading to thrush (a fungal or yeast infection). Symptoms like vaginal itching, discharge, or a white coating on the mouth or tongue should be reported to your doctor immediately, whether they occur during or after treatment.
